Problem: our users all have roaming profiles but they work in offices all over the country and they sometimes 'forget' to logoff while they go to another office where they want to logon again with the same roaming profile. We're using win2003 servers with winxp desk- and laptops. Question: Is there any way the server can logoff a user (roaming profile) on the first machine when the user tries to log on from a different machine? Any help would be appreciated.
